hello friends in this video I try to build a winding machine by using Self reversing screw.
Self reversing screw can change its horizontal movement though shaft is rotation in same direction, this type of screw element lots of mechanism for horizontal motion as a winder.
We just need to rotate the shaft in single direction the horizontal motion of thread guide will automatically change when it reach its most left or right corner.

Used to work at a subsea robotics company and this is the exact mechanism that was used to spool and unspool our 5000m long tethers to the robots out at sea. Cool to see it in miniature form!

Leesona winding machines worked this way and had a weird mechanical glitch that caused them to wind guitar pickups in just the right way, making them more valuable than modern servo-controlled winders. I learned this when I toured some coil winding factories for a work project.

Such screws have been used in industry for nearly two centuries (though typically made from metal). If you want to see one in another application search for Yankee Screwdriver. They were a very common tool in use before electric screwdrivers were commonly available.
